yesterday my pc rebooted itself and when it came back up all the images on the monitor were too big, I went into Appearances and changed it back to 100% but it was still much bigger than it was before the reboot, I reduced the size of the icons but the start bar is still way too big and when I open a browser, my tool bars take up half the screen. I tried a system restore but it didn't help any ideas?

Hello ksimp, and welcome to Seven Forums.

You might check to see if your screen resolution is still set to the native resolution for you monitor, and that Magnifier is not currently running and making things look bigger.
